Over 5,000 illegal residents, including mostly Bangladeshis and Indians, have applied to leave the Kingdom under the LMRA’s ongoing Easy Exit scheme. Speaking to the Bahrain Tribune, representatives from the Bangladeshi and Indian embassies explained that of these, an estimated 3,000 have probably already left the Kingdom. Continue reading

MANAMA – A total of 338 illegal expatriate workers have been arrested by authorities in Bahrain, out of whom 110 face deportation. The arrests followed inspection raids carried out between January and June. Continue reading
